Smackover is moderately more affordable than Bauxite, with a 14% lower cost of living index. Bauxite scores 75 compared to 66 for Smackover, where the US average is 100. This difference means residents of Bauxite can expect to pay noticeably more for everyday expenses, housing, and services.

On the housing front, median rent in Bauxite is $913/month compared to $845/month in Smackover — a 8% difference. Home values follow the same pattern: Smackover is more affordable at $113,100 median vs $196,300.

Median household income in Bauxite is $72,778 compared to $53,105 in Smackover (+37%). While Bauxite is more expensive, its higher salaries more than compensate — residents there may actually end up with more disposable income. Looking at affordability, residents of Bauxite spend roughly 15.1% of their income on rent, less than the 19.1% in Smackover.
